# KIP-0031: Deterministic Local Proxy Ingress Prototype

## Purpose

Milestone 25 turns the proxy ingress design review into a deterministic local prototype. The prototype accepts synthetic CONNECT-like request events, validates safe target descriptors, maps requests into runtime stream metadata, exercises bounded queue behavior, and emits payload-free summaries.

The research question is whether a local ingress-style flow can move through the existing runtime boundary while preserving backpressure, reset/error isolation, trace hygiene, generated-backend parity, and deterministic fixture stability.

## Architecture

```text
synthetic local request source
        |
        v
local proxy ingress runner
        |
        v
target descriptor validation
        |
        v
runtime stream mapping
        |
        v
bounded queue / backpressure model
        |
        v
safe trace summary and audit gates
```

The prototype remains deterministic and in-memory. It does not open sockets, listen for real proxy traffic, parse public protocols, or contact external targets.

## Limitations

This prototype is an in-memory deterministic harness. It does not implement concrete proxy ingress, socket handling, DNS behavior, HTTP carrier behavior, TLS mimicry, VPN/TUN semantics, deployment, external targets, or live measurement.

The prototype validates local contracts and regression gates. It does not prove real-world censorship resistance or production readiness.
